Shield volcanoes on Mars differ from terrestrial ones primarily in which aspect?

  1. Composition
  2. Size and longevity
  3. Eruption style
  4. Tectonic setting

Answer: Size and longevity

Martian shield volcanoes (e.g., Olympus Mons) are vastly larger due to stationary crust over mantle plumes, allowing prolonged eruptions without plate tectonics.
